Toshihiko Inoue is a scholar working on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Otorhinolaryngology and Oncology. According to data from OpenAlex, Toshihiko Inoue has authored 196 papers receiving a total of 2.9k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 54 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, 46 papers in Otorhinolaryngology and 42 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in Toshihiko Inoue’s work include Head and Neck Cancer Studies (46 papers), Advanced Radiotherapy Techniques (32 papers) and Cancer Diagnosis and Treatment (16 papers). Toshihiko Inoue is often cited by papers focused on Head and Neck Cancer Studies (46 papers), Advanced Radiotherapy Techniques (32 papers) and Cancer Diagnosis and Treatment (16 papers). Toshihiko Inoue collaborates with scholars based in Japan, United States and China. Toshihiko Inoue's co-authors include Teruki Teshima, M Chatani, Takehiro Inoue, Hideya Yamazaki, Hiroya Shiomi, Ryoong‐Jin Oh, Ken Yoshida, Souhei Furukawa, Kimishige Shimizutani and Eiichi Tanaka and has published in prestigious journals such as Circulation, Chemistry of Materials and Cancer.
